WebStandard Order of Authorities - As Per Bluebook Rule 1.4. 1. Constitutions, in the following order -. a) U.S. Federal Constitution. b) U.S. state constitutions, alphabetically by state. c) Foreign, alphabetically by jurisdiction. d) Foundational documents of the United Nations, League of Nations, and European Union (in that order) 2. WebWhen citing multiple works parenthetically, place the citations in alphabetical order, separating them with semicolons. (Adams et al., 2024; Shumway & Shulman, 2015; Westinghouse, 2024) Arrange two or more works by the same authors by year of publication. Place citations with no date first.
